Color Palette and Symbolism

The color palette of the Nike Korea National Team Jersey is a powerful statement. Red and white are the dominant colors, taken directly from the Korean flag, the Taegeukgi. Red symbolizes energy, passion, and courage, while white represents purity and peace. These colors are strategically used to create a strong visual identity. The symbolism behind the colors is deeply rooted in Korean culture and history. The Taegeukgi flag itself is a symbol of national identity, and the colors reflect the core values of the Korean people. The color choices are not merely aesthetic; they have a profound meaning. Online Retailers and Authenticity Checks

When buying the Nike Korea National Team Jersey online, always prioritize authenticity. Shop from reputable online retailers to guarantee you are purchasing a genuine product. Check customer reviews and ratings to gauge the retailer's reliability and customer service. Look for detailed product descriptions, including images and material details. Carefully examine the jersey's features, like the Nike logo, crest, and stitching. Avoid sellers offering prices that seem too good to be true, as they may be selling counterfeit items. Verify the jersey's authenticity by comparing it with images of authentic jerseys. Seek out retailers that provide clear return policies, just in case you need to address issues.
